> OK, my binutils patch just got rejected because "Fedora Core 2 isn't
> ported to the ARM."

If you have FC2 based port, please keep the patch local to the ARM port
(say have binutils-2.15.90.0.3-5xscale.src.rpm instead of what was shipped
in FC2 - e.g. Fedora Core SPARC port does the same).

I don't think it is a good idea to issue FC2 updates just because there
was an ARM patch added, FC2 users on i386/x86-64 would IMHO definitely
not appreciate having to download the updates with zero changes.

binutils in FC3 will be 2.15.91.0.2 (~end of July '04) or later, so the
patch in question is definitely there for FC3.
